Glad you got the carb going Armand. Now make sure you fire it up every 4-5 weeks and let it run with the ac on. That should keep the carb cleaned out for you. I once had to clean out the carb in our Onan. Now I make sure to run the thing with a load on a regular basis. I let the one on my Kipor get clogged up and it was a real booger to clean that one.
Now, you will love the elec ignition from Applied. With the primer button and the electronic ignition, our Onan fires up like a new one every time. Good choice on upgrades.
